What does an electrical computer engineer do?

An Electrical Computer Engineer designs, develops, and tests electrical systems and computer hardware, integrating both disciplines to create efficient electronic and computing solutions. They work on circuits, embedded systems, processors, and digital communication networks across industries like telecommunications, robotics, and automotive. Their role often involves troubleshooting, optimizing performance, and ensuring hardware-software compatibility for innovative technological advancements.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an electrical computer engineer?

To thrive as an Electrical Computer Engineer, you typically need a strong background in electrical engineering, computer architecture, programming, and design principles, supported by at least a bachelor's degree in electrical or computer engineering. Familiarity with tools such as MATLAB, SPICE, CAD software, FPGA development kits, and relevant certifications like PE (Professional Engineer) or CompTIA are commonly beneficial. Strong analytical thinking, teamwork, and communication skills help you solve complex problems and collaborate effectively across multidisciplinary teams. Possessing these skills is important to successfully develop, test, and implement efficient hardware and software systems that meet industry requirements.

What are the typical career paths and advancement opportunities for electrical computer engineers?

Electrical Computer Engineers often start in entry-level roles focused on hardware or embedded systems design before progressing to more specialized or senior engineering positions, such as project lead, systems architect, or engineering manager. Many professionals choose to acquire advanced degrees or certifications, enabling them to enter research, product development, or executive roles. As technology evolves, there are expanding opportunities to move into areas like IoT, AI hardware, robotics, or integrated circuit design. Companies value continuous learning and innovation, so proactive engineers can grow rapidly by taking on challenging projects and collaborating across engineering and software development teams.

WHAT YOU'LL BE DOING:
This person will bring extensive experience to work on industrial projects including design of power distribution, lighting and grounding systems. Projects range from small facility modifications to complex EPC contracts for heavy industrial processes in any one or more of the pulp and paper, chemicals, food and beverage, consumer products, or pharmaceutical industries. Some travel to project and construction sites will be required.
Design power system facilities and equipment and coordinate construction, operation, and maintenance of electric power generating, receiving, and distribution stations, and distribution systems and equipment
Develop conceptual layouts and sketches to drive the most efficient design on a project-by-project basis
Participate in the planning, scheduling, conducting and coordinating detailed phases of electrical engineering projects
Develop equipment specifications
Develop construction specifications and contractor scope of work documents
Directs preparation of or prepares drawings and specific type of equipment and materials to be used, in construction and equipment installation
Inspects completed installations for conformance with design and equipment specifications and safety standards
Work products will include: one-line diagrams, wiring drawings, panel layout drawings, motor schematics, instrument loop sheets, conduit and tray routing drawings and contractor scope documents
Work with systems and equipment grounding requirements (high resistance, building and isolated grounding)
Provide on-site start up support
